This makes sense: we’ve seen the market for malware mature so that some people and companies offer specific, specialized services. The chart below shows the different malware families we found using OnionCrypter.īecause of how long OnionCrypter has been around and how widely it’s used, our researchers believe that the authors of OnionCrypter offer it for sale as a service. In the last three years, we have protected almost 400,000 Avast users around the world from malware that makes use of OnionCrypter. We also found that OnionCrypter has been widely used since 2016 by some of the best known and most prevalent malware families such as Ursnif, Lokibot, Zeus, AgentTesla, and Smokeloader, among others. It’s important to note that the name reflects the many layers this crypter uses, and it’s in no way related to the Tor browser or network. OnionCrypter is unusual because of the way it uses multiple layers to hide its information. Put simply, the information is hidden within the layers of the “onion” of its encryption. We’ve chosen this name because this particular crypter uses multiple techniques to make it harder for researchers, antivirus, and security software to read the information that it protects. Our researchers looked into a specific crypter that we’re calling OnionCrypter.
